Maran Thamilarasan is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Epidemiology. According to data from OpenAlex, Maran Thamilarasan has authored 58 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 55 papers in Cardiology and Cardiovascular Medicine, 11 papers in Surgery and 10 papers in Epidemiology. Recurrent topics in Maran Thamilarasan’s work include Cardiomyopathy and Myosin Studies (42 papers), Cardiovascular Function and Risk Factors (39 papers) and Cardiovascular Effects of Exercise (15 papers). Maran Thamilarasan is often cited by papers focused on Cardiomyopathy and Myosin Studies (42 papers), Cardiovascular Function and Risk Factors (39 papers) and Cardiovascular Effects of Exercise (15 papers). Maran Thamilarasan collaborates with scholars based in United States, Australia and Lebanon. Maran Thamilarasan's co-authors include Milind Y. Desai, Harry M. Lever, Nicholas G. Smedira, Bruce W. Lytle, Eugene H. Blackstone, Deborah Kwon, Junko Watanabe, Michael S. Lauer, James D. Thomas and Zoran Popović and has published in prestigious journals such as JAMA, Circulation and Journal of the American College of Cardiology.
